Essential Care Routine for Curly Hair
Now that we’ve talked about the why, let’s get into the how. Caring for curly hair over 60 requires a bit of effort, but trust me, it’s worth it. Here’s a step-by-step guide:
Step 1: Washing
Wash your hair with a sulfate-free shampoo once or twice a week. Sulfates can strip your hair of its natural oils, leaving it dry and brittle. Instead, opt for gentle formulas designed for curly hair.
Step 2: Conditioning
Deep conditioning is key for maintaining moisture. Look for products rich in shea butter or argan oil. Apply the conditioner from mid-length to ends, then let it sit for 15-20 minutes before rinsing.
Step 3: Styling
Use a diffuser attachment on your hairdryer to reduce frizz and enhance definition. Alternatively, let your curls air-dry for a more natural look. Whatever method you choose, make sure to apply a lightweight leave-in conditioner to keep your curls hydrated.

Styling Tips for Mature Curls
Styling curly hair over 60 doesn’t have to be complicated. Here are a few tips to keep in mind:
First, always detangle your hair when it’s wet. Wet hair is more pliable, making it easier to work with. Use a wide-tooth comb or your fingers to gently remove knots.
Second, avoid touching your curls while they dry. This can cause frizz and disrupt the natural pattern of your curls. If you must touch your hair, do so lightly and with clean hands.

Common Challenges and How to Overcome Them
No journey is without its bumps, and curly hair over 60 is no exception. Here are some common challenges and how to tackle them:
Challenge 1: Dryness
Dryness is a frequent issue for curly hair, especially as we age. Combat this by incorporating more moisturizing products into your routine. Regular deep conditioning treatments can also help keep your hair hydrated.
Challenge 2: Frizz
Frizz happens, but it doesn’t have to ruin your day. Use a smoothing serum or anti-frizz cream to tame flyaways. Additionally, avoid brushing your hair when it’s dry, as this can cause breakage and increase frizz.
